SAM Racing to campaign with 2 World Champions in the 2009 WesBank Super Series
SAM Racing has announced that it will contest the 2009 Bridgestone Production Car Championship with two ex-Sasol Nissan 350Zs under the banner of the Nissan Dealer Team. The cars will be driven by Leeroy Poulter, the 2006 national production car champion, who came second in last year's class A championship in a factory Sasol Nissan 350Z, and Marco da Cunha, who led the Nissan Dealer Team's campaign in 2008.
"We are very excited to have Leeroy join Marco and the team for the new season. He brings with him a wealth of driving experience as well as an intimate knowledge of setting up the Nissan 350Z," said Lee Philips, team principal of SAM Racing.
"We are also very honoured to be the official representatives of Nissan in circuit racing in 2009, following the factory team's withdrawal from the competition at the end of last year. In addition to purchasing the two Sasol Nissan 350Zs, we have also acquired all their technology, spares and parts and we have been assured of Nissan Motorsport's technical support when we need it. We have always done our best to deliver maximum performance on the race track in our privateer Nissans and we will be equally dedicated to flying the Nissan flag high in this the company's 50th anniversary year of its debut in South African motor sport in 1959," added Philips.
SAM Racing will also run two cars in the inaugural Formula Volkswagen National Championship in 2009 after supporting the FVW Challenge in 2008. The driver line-up is to be the same as in 2008, namely Paulo da Cunha and Wesleigh Orr. "Our permanent staffing has been increased to accommodate the anticipated demands of campaigning for the prestigious SA Drivers' Championship, a title that will go to the winner of the FVW Championship," said Philips. "In addition, the team will support a third driver in 2009, details of which will be announced at a later stage."
